150476Speter/* This file is automatically generated. DO NOT EDIT! */ 21638Srgrimes/* Generated from: NetBSD: mknative-gcc,v 1.118 2024/02/21 08:24:46 mrg Exp */ 3172476Sedwin/* Generated from: NetBSD: mknative.common,v 1.16 2018/04/15 15:13:37 christos Exp */ 4172476Sedwin 5172476Sedwin/* generated for aarch64--netbsd-gcc (NetBSD nb1 20240630) 12.4.0 */ 6181426Sedwin 7172476Sedwin#ifndef GCC_GENERATED_STDINT_H 8181426Sedwin#define GCC_GENERATED_STDINT_H 1 9172476Sedwin 10181426Sedwin#include <sys/types.h> 11181426Sedwin#include <stdint.h> 12181426Sedwin/* glibc uses these symbols as guards to prevent redefinitions. */ 13181426Sedwin#ifdef __int8_t_defined 14172476Sedwin#define _INT8_T 15181426Sedwin#define _INT16_T 16172476Sedwin#define _INT32_T 17181426Sedwin#endif 18181426Sedwin#ifdef __uint32_t_defined 19181426Sedwin#define _UINT32_T 20183865Sedwin#endif 21172476Sedwin 22181426Sedwin 23172476Sedwin/* Some systems have guard macros to prevent redefinitions, define them. */ 24183865Sedwin#ifndef _INT8_T 25181426Sedwin#define _INT8_T 26183865Sedwin#endif 27181426Sedwin#ifndef _INT16_T 28183865Sedwin#define _INT16_T 29172476Sedwin#endif 30172476Sedwin#ifndef _INT32_T 312747Swollman#define _INT32_T 32204300Sedwin#endif 33204300Sedwin#ifndef _UINT8_T 341638Srgrimes#define _UINT8_T 352747Swollman#endif 3612319Sgpalmer#ifndef _UINT16_T 372747Swollman#define _UINT16_T 3812319Sgpalmer#endif 392747Swollman#ifndef _UINT32_T 401638Srgrimes#define _UINT32_T 412747Swollman#endif 42149653Swollman 432747Swollman/* system headers have good uint64_t and int64_t */ 441638Srgrimes#ifndef _INT64_T 452747Swollman#define _INT64_T 46149653Swollman#endif 472747Swollman#ifndef _UINT64_T 481638Srgrimes#define _UINT64_T 49204300Sedwin#endif 50204300Sedwin 5123569Sbde#endif /* GCC_GENERATED_STDINT_H */ 521638Srgrimes